Lululemon’s stock to join S&P 500 index

1 Mins read

Lululemon Athletica Inc.’s stock rallied more than 5% in the after-hours session Friday after S&P Dow Jones Indices said the stock will join the S&P 500 index next week.

Lululemon’s
LULU,
+1.00%
shares will replace video-game company Activision Blizzard Inc.’s on the S&P 500
SPX,
the index provider said. The changes are effective before the stock-market open on Wednesday.
